𝗗𝗲𝗰𝗹𝗮𝗿𝗮𝘁𝗶𝗼𝗻 by 𝗖𝗮𝗿𝘁𝗶𝗲𝗿 is a Woody Floral Musk fragrance and was launched in 1998. It was created by Jean-Claude Ellena.
Top notes are Bitter Orange, Caraway, Birch, Bergamot, Coriander, Mandarin Orange, Neroli and Artemisia. Middle notes are Guatemalan Cardamom, Pepper, Ginger, iris, Juniper, Cinnamon, Orris Root and Jasmine. Base notes are Tahitian Vetiver, Tea, Cedar, Leather, Oakmoss and Amber.
